Awesome
<div align="center"> <span align="center"> <img width="128" height="128" class="center" src="data/icons/hicolor/scalable/apps/io.github.alainm23.planify.svg" alt="Planify Icon"></span> <h1 align="center">Planify</h1> <h3 align="center">Never worry about forgetting things again</h3> </div>Planify is here...
- ποΈ Neat visual style.
- π€οΈ Drag and Order: Sort your tasks wherever you want.
- π―οΈ Progress indicator for each project.
- πͺοΈ Be more productive and organize your tasks by 'Sections'.
- π οΈ Visualize your events and plan your day better.
- β²οΈ Reminder system, you can create one or more reminders, you decide.
- ποΈ Better integration with the dark theme.
- ποΈ and much more.
βοΈ Support for Todoist & Nextcloud:
- Synchronize your Projects, Tasks and Sections.
- Support for Todoist offline: Work without an internet connection; when everything is reconnected, it will be synchronized.
- Planify is not created by, affiliated with, or supported by Doist
ποΈ Other features:
- β²οΈ Reminders notifications.
- ποΈ Quick Find.
- ποΈ Night mode.
- ποΈ Recurring due dates.
Install
Official
Release
<a href="https://flathub.org/apps/details/io.github.alainm23.planify" rel="noreferrer noopener" target="_blank"><img loading="lazy" draggable="false" width='240' alt='Download on Flathub' src='https://dl.flathub.org/assets/badges/flathub-badge-en.png' /></a>
<!-- <a href="https://snapcraft.io/planify"> <img alt="Get it from the Snap Store" src="https://snapcraft.io/static/images/badges/en/snap-store-black.svg" loading="lazy" width='240' draggable="false"/> </a> -->π From Source
You'll need the following dependencies:
<details> <summary>Dependencies</summary>Package Name | Required Version |
---|---|
meson | 0.56 |
valac | 0.48 |
gio-2.0 | 2.80.3 |
glib-2.0 | 2.80.3 |
gee-0.8 | 0.20.6 |
gtk4 | 4.14.4 |
libsoup-3.0 | 3.4.4 |
sqlite3 | 3.45.1 |
libadwaita-1 | 1.5.3 |
webkitgtk-6.0 | 2.44.3 |
gtksourceview-5 | 5.12.1 |
granite-7 | 7.4.0 |
json-glib-1.0 | 1.8.0 |
libecal-2.0 | 3.52.4 |
libedataserver-1.2 | 3.52.4 |
libportal | 0.7.1 |
libportal-gtk4 | 0.7.1 |
gxml-0.20 | 0.21.0 |
libsecret-1 | 0.21.4 |
Run meson build
to configure the build environment. Change to the build directory and run ninja
to build
meson build --prefix=/usr
cd build
ninja
To install, use ninja install
, then execute with io.github.alainm23.planify
sudo ninja install
io.github.alainm23.planify
GNOME Builder
- Clone
- Open in GNOME Builder
Code of conduct
Planify follows the GNOME Code of Conduct.
- Be friendly. Use welcoming and inclusive language.
- Be empathetic. Be respectful of differing viewpoints and experiences.
- Be respectful. When we disagree, we do so politely and constructively.
- Be considerate. Remember that decisions are often difficult when competing priorities are involved.
- Be patient and generous. If someone asks for help it is because they need it.
- Try to be concise. Read the discussion before commenting.
Support
If you like Planify and want to support its development, consider supporting via Patreon, PayPal or Liberapay
Made with π in PerΓΊ